Rachael's Blog:

3/08/09 I decided it was about time to start some training....i went for an hours uphill walk and managed to cover a distance of 5km. Came away feeling brilliant....the next day my hip hurt loads...brilliant start!!! On a plus side though my boots were really comfy

5/08/09 Got my hands on some waterproof trousers and jacket today...Starting to get things together for my kit :) I will be climbing Scafell pike this weekend-will let you all know how it goes :D

10/08/09 Ok so the waterproofs i got didn't work! I was soaked through to the bone and freezing cold. The climb up Scafell Pike was very challenging and it made me realise i need to do lots of training. We didnt quite make it to the top because the weather got worse and so we had to turn back as it was too dangerous. Never mind, the climb was very good and we all had a good laugh :)

Climb Your Mountain (CYM) provides free outdoor activities and educational help so children, adults and families can benefit by improving their confidence, self-esteem, health and wellbeing and thus climbing their own personal mountain.
